Choosing a 410 Derringer: Is It Suitable? Benefits and Drawbacks
If you're considering the idea of adding a 410 Derringer to your arsenal, it's crucial to weigh both its advantages and disadvantages. This pocket-sized powerhouse packs a punch for self-defense or close-range situations, but it comes with some caveats too. We'll delve into the pros and cons to help you determine if this compact firearm is right for your needs.
- Pros:
- Compact size makes it easy to carry concealed.
- Powerful stopping power at close range.
- Simple operation
- Drawbacks:
- Short effective distance
- Requires careful shot placement
- Can be difficult to control for inexperienced shooters
Ultimately, the determination of whether a 410 Derringer is right for you depends on your individual requirements. Think about your intended use, experience level, and personal preferences before making a acquisition.
Glock Reliability Concerns: When Your Gen 5 Malfunctionsacts up
Glocks are renowned for their reliability, but even the best firearms can suffer from issues. Gen 5 Glocks, while generally well-regarded, aren't immune to malfunctions. When your Gen 5 sputters, it can be frustrating and potentially dangerous. Understanding common causes of malfunction is crucial for troubleshooting and can get back on target quickly.
- A dirty firearm is a recipe for problems. Debris, grime, and residue can hinder smooth operation and lead to stovepiping
- Magazines play a vital role in reliability. Faulty magazines can cause feeding issues, so inspect them regularly for any signs of damage or wear.
- Improper ammunition can trigger malfunctions. Always use factory-loaded ammunition that is compatible with your Glock's caliber and barrel length.
If you're experiencing recurring malfunctions, don't hesitate to contact a qualified gunsmith for professional inspection and repair. Regular maintenance, proper cleaning, and using quality ammunition can go a long way in ensuring the reliability of your Gen 5 Glock.
